Interim Payroll Manager

6-Month Interim Contract

£300–£400 per day | Inside IR35
Southwest London – 50/50 Hybrid Working

We're supporting a well-established national building services business that is looking to appoint an experienced Interim Payroll Manager for an initial six-month contract.

This is a hands-on role taking ownership of the monthly payroll for around 260 employees, more than half of whom receive overtime or other variable pay. The current process is detailed and largely manual, so they need someone who genuinely understands payroll and is comfortable getting into the detail.

Alongside running BAU payroll, the big project will be supporting and ultimately owning the move from an in-house payroll to an outsourced provider. You'll see the project through to go-live, check the new provider's output and help ensure the transition is properly embedded before the administrative elements are handed over internally.

The Role

Reporting into the Head of Finance, you'll take day-to-day ownership of payroll while managing the transition to the new outsourced model.

There are effectively two profiles that could work here. It could suit an experienced Payroll Controller / Payroll Manager who has led an outsourcing or payroll migration before, or a strong Senior Payroll Officer / Payroll Supervisor who can confidently run payroll and has been involved in a migration previously and is ready to step up.

Either way, this needs someone practical. There is some general administration attached to the role, so they need someone who is happy to roll their sleeves up and do whatever needs doing rather than being precious about the job description.

Key Responsibilities

  • Take ownership of the monthly payroll for around 260 employees, including significant volumes of overtime, absence and variable pay
  • Review payroll for accuracy and ensure ongoing compliance with HMRC legislation
  • Complete month-end payroll activities including HMRC submissions, pensions and payroll journals
  • Process manual gross-to-net calculations, bonuses, termination payments and statutory payments including SSP, SMP and SPP
  • Work closely with HR on starters, leavers and pay changes, while managing payroll queries from employees and managers
  • Manage day-to-day benefits administration including pensions and private medical insurance
  • Take ownership of the transition to an outsourced payroll provider, coordinating the move through to go-live
  • Review initial outsourced payroll runs, identify issues and ensure the new process is operating accurately before supporting the final handover
  • Pick up wider administration where required, including some fleet-related and general office administration

What We're Looking For

  • Experienced Payroll Controller, Payroll Manager, Senior Payroll Officer or Payroll Supervisor
  • Strong hands-on experience running a busy, variable payroll, ideally with significant overtime and manual adjustments
  • Previous involvement in a payroll outsourcing, implementation or system migration – ideally having led one, although strong supporting experience will be considered
  • Good technical payroll knowledge including statutory payments, HMRC requirements, pensions, journals and gross-to-net calculations
  • Confident taking ownership of payroll and working independently with Finance and HR
  • Good Excel skills with strong attention to detail and organisation
  • Practical, flexible and happy to pick up wider administration alongside the core payroll responsibilities
  • Available immediately or at short notice
